About Eat Parramatta
EaT. – Experience Asian Taste EaT. is a bold new dining concept redefining how Australia experiences Asian food. Standing for Experience Asian Taste, EaT. brings together the best of Chinese, Japanese, Korean, and Vietnamese cuisine — all under one roof, all in one flexible format. Our menu changes daily, showcasing up to 15 freshly prepared dishes inspired by authentic Asian flavours. At EaT., you’re in control — choose your portion size, pick as many items as you like, and as long as you can close the lid, it’s yours. No limits. No judgement. Just real food, your way!
